DIFFERENT-BY-DESIGN — market buy idempotency & id-space, in full: +//! * Python behaviour: `trade_route` reconstructs a buyable auction from the +//! SAMPLE pool every call (`_auction_by_tradeid(tid)` = PACK_POOL[tid-900000000]); +//! it holds no per-listing sold state, so POSTing the same sample tradeId twice +//! debits `buyNowPrice` twice and grants twice. The user's OWN listings live in +//! a separate id space (`list_for_sale` -> 900500000+seq) surfaced only by +//! `/tradePile`, and are NOT buyable via `/trade/{id}` (that returns an empty +//! auction). Evidence: probed live — buying sample tradeId 900000000 twice each +//! returned `tradeState:"closed"` with a -buyNow coin delta both times. +//! * Rust behaviour: `handle_market_buy` reserves+sells against a durable +//! `MarketStore` keyed by the listing's own tradeId (unified with the sale +//! pile); a second buy of a `sold` listing is a no-op (0 coin delta, empty +//! `auctionInfo`). Evidence: asserted below (second buy delta 0). +//! * Reason: the oracle is a single-file, single-profile emulator whose sample +//! market exists only to make the client's Transfer Market browsable; it never +//! needed durable auction state. The Rust cutover makes the market a real, +//! crash-consistent, single-debit ledger backed by SQLite. Compatibility +//! impact: NONE for the client — a buy-now is a one-shot UI action, so the +//! re-debit path was never reachable in normal play; the Rust behaviour is a +//! strict correctness improvement and is pinned by assertion so it cannot +//! regress toward the stateless oracle shape. +//! +//!
